我们建立了一列基础动画,和简单的增加他们到层上面。如果你想要所有的动 画开始在同样的时间,并且他们中每个动画都有同样的执行时间,这个方法是足够了 - (IBAction)animate:(id)sender ...
先在自定义的ViewController里声明定义一个UIImageView 在viewDidLoad函数里添加图片,并执行组合动画 ...
2012-02-10 15:14 0 13129 推荐指数:
我们建立了一列基础动画,和简单的增加他们到层上面。如果你想要所有的动 画开始在同样的时间,并且他们中每个动画都有同样的执行时间,这个方法是足够了 - (IBAction)animate:(id)sender ...
CAAnimationGroup——动画组 动画组,是CAAnimation的子类,可以保存一组动画对象,将CAAnimationGroup对象加入层后,组中所有动画对象可以同时并发运行 属性说明: –animations:用来保存一组动画对象的NSArray ...
老孟导读:在前面的文章中介绍了 《Flutter 动画系列》25种动画组件超全总结 http://laomengit.com/flutter/module/animated_1/ 《Flutter 动画系列》Google工程师带你选择Flutter动画控件 ...
使用NGUI的Tween做补间动画,难免会涉及组合各种Tween。最常用的就是 Scale+Alpha组合 做淡入淡出了。那么如何控制 播放完一个Tween 后在 播放另一个Tween呢?利用delayPlay 。比如:第一个tween 直接播放Scale动画,用时1s 。此时播放Alpha动画 ...
首先引入框架:QuartzCore.framework在头文件声明:CALayer *logoLayer{//界限CABasicAnimation *boundsAnimation = [CAB ...
目录 一、什么是组合 二、为什么用组合 三、如何用组合 一、什么是组合 组合就是一个类的对象具备某一个属性,该属性的值是指向另外外一个类的对象 二、为什么用组合 组合是用来解决类与类之间代码冗余的问题 首先我们先写一个 ...
目录 组合与封装 一、组合 二、封装 三、访问限制机制 四、property 组合与封装 一、组合 什么是组合 组合指的是一个对象中,包含另一个或多个对象 为什么要用组合 ...
排列组合是组合学最基本的概念。所谓排列,就是指从给定个数的元素中取出指定个数的元素进行排序。组合则是指从给定个数的元素中仅仅取出指定个数的元素,不考虑排序。 排列与组合在日常生活中应用较广,比如在考虑某些事物在某种情况下出现的次数时,往往需要用到排列和组合。 【例 ...